Abstract This paper presents a novel investigation that establishes the uniqueness and analyticity of the fractional solution to a fractional electromagnetic boundary value problem (BVP). The BVP is defined by specifying the tangential electromagnetic components. It has been proven that the analytical expressions for the fractional electromagnetic fields E α , E *α , H α , and H *α do not vanish in any subregions Ω α o or Ω α - Ω α o . Furthermore, the unique solution makes E α = E *α and H α = and H *α without singular fields at same region of the space. Analyticity of the fractional time-harmonic electromagnetic field within lossy or lossless dielectric regions is proven. This paper is generalization of works [2,4] and [24,25].
